4. Creator Agreement

4.1 Revenue Share

Creators receive 70% of all revenue generated through the Platform. 365 Entertainment retains 30% to cover platform operations, payment processing, and support services.

4.2 Payment Terms

  • Payments are processed monthly
  • Minimum payout threshold: $50 CAD
  • Creators are responsible for applicable taxes
  • Chargebacks may be deducted from future earnings

4.3 Tax Responsibilities

Creators are responsible for reporting all income and paying applicable taxes. We will provide tax documentation as required by law.

5. Content License

5.1 Your Content

You retain all ownership rights to your content. By uploading content to the Platform, you grant us a non-exclusive, worldwide, royalty-free license to:

  • Host, store, and display your content
  • Distribute your content to users
  • Promote your content on and off the Platform
  • Modify content for technical processing (transcoding, etc.)

5.2 Content Standards

All content must:

  • Be created by you or you must have all necessary rights
  • Comply with our Acceptable Use Policy
  • Not violate any laws or third-party rights
  • Feature only individuals who have consented to appear

7. Termination

7.1 By You

You may terminate your account at any time by contacting support. Upon termination:

  • Your content will be removed from public view
  • You will receive any outstanding earnings (subject to minimum threshold)
  • Your license to use the Platform ends immediately

7.2 By Us

We may suspend or terminate your account for:

  • Violation of these Terms
  • Violation of our Acceptable Use Policy
  • Fraudulent or illegal activity
  • Non-payment of fees (if applicable)
